XRP Mining: Dispelling Myths and Exploring Alternatives in 2025

XRP stands out in the cryptocurrency landscape for its speed, low transaction costs, and enterprise adoption. Yet, a persistent question lingers: Can XRP be mined? The answer is unequivocal—no. Unlike Bitcoin, which relies on a proof-of-work mechanism to mint new coins, XRP's entire supply of 100 billion tokens was pre-mined at launch by Ripple Labs.

The consensus model governing XRP eliminates mining rewards, with validators maintaining the network without earning new tokens. Ripple controls the release of XRP through strategic partnerships and ecosystem incentives, not mining. For those seeking exposure to XRP, alternatives like staking, trading, or participating in liquidity programs offer viable paths.

Ripple Files Volume 1 of OCC Banking License Application for National Trust Bank

Ripple Labs has submitted the first volume of its application to the Office of the Comptroller of the Currency (OCC) for a national trust bank charter. The proposed Ripple National Trust Bank WOULD operate as a limited-purpose subsidiary headquartered in New York, focusing on fiduciary activities rather than traditional deposit-taking or lending.

CEO Brad Garlinghouse emphasized the strategic shift toward federal oversight for RLUSD, Ripple's forthcoming stablecoin. "This establishes a new benchmark for trust in the stablecoin market," he stated in a July 2 announcement. The trust structure intentionally avoids Community Reinvestment Act requirements by excluding retail banking functions.

The filing reveals concentrated infrastructure ambitions—custody services and compliance frameworks will anchor operations. Notably absent is any direct mention of XRP, the company's flagship cryptocurrency, signaling a deliberate pivot toward regulated stablecoin solutions.
